Description
Casa Mariuccia is a historical residence that was built by the Visconti marquises in the 1400s. It is located in the heart of the old village of Massino Visconti, with the Mount San Salvatore behind it, and it overlooks Lake Maggiore like a blossoming balcony.

Area city center
Massino Visconti is a village located at an altitude of approximately 460 meters above sea level. It boasts a combination of enchanting ingredients, including being a fiefdom and a holiday spot for the Visconti family. The village is nestled between Mount San Salvatore, where the Hermitage of the Benedictines is located, and Lake Maggiore, resembling a blooming balcony overlooking the lake.
Thanks to its sunny location, Massino Visconti enjoys a particularly pleasant climate that promotes the blossoming of azaleas, camellias, and rhododendrons. Lakes, islands, mountains, characteristic towns, and both natural and man-made wonders await discovery.
Visitors can explore or take advantage of golf courses such as the Des Iles Borromees and Alpino, take a stroll along the lakeside promenade of Stresa, attend the musical weeks, visit the zoological garden of Villa Pallavicino, check out the botanical garden of Villa Taranto in Pallanza, go shopping in Arona, hike to the Monte Rosa and the Toce waterfall in Val d'Ossola, and finally, explore the picturesque San Giulio Island in Orta.
